The Reggae EZX (v1.0.2) is a specialized expansion for EZdrummer 2/3 and Superior Drummer 2.4/3, recorded at the renowned Ruba Dub Studios in Stockholm, Sweden. This expansion captures the saturated, warm tones essential for roots, dub, and rocksteady. 1. Included Kits & Instruments

The library features two primary kits recorded with vintage gear to provide authentic reggae textures:

1970s Premier Club: This kit delivers a cohesive, "magical" sound typical of classic Ruba Dub recordings. It features heavily damped toms and a "woody" snare.

Yamaha Stage Custom: A more versatile, modern-sounding kit with more tone, customized specifically for reggae production.

Percussion Pieces: Essential for the genre, including Timbales, Octobans, Binghi and Clay Drums, Woodblocks, and Vibraslap.

The Reggae EZX is an authentic sound library expansion designed for Toontrack EZdrummer and Superior Drummer. Recorded at the renowned Rub-a-Dub Studios in Stockholm, Sweden, this expansion captures the saturated, warm, and rich tones essential for roots-oriented music, ska, and dancehall. Core Features and Sound Profile

The expansion focuses on the organic, tight, and "rubber dub" sounds that define the reggae genre. Over 1,200 drum samples, including kick drums, snare

Authentic Drum Kits: Includes two full, single-headed custom kits: a 1970s Premier Club kit and a Yamaha Stage Custom.

Specialized Recording: Tracks were recorded through a vintage 1970s Soundcraft Series II console using period-accurate microphones and techniques, such as toms with the bottom heads removed.

Rich Percussion: Features a broad selection of traditional hand drums, including Binghi and clay drums, plus octabons, wood blocks, a vibra-slap, and a timbale.

Custom Presets: Comes with mix-ready effect chain presets designed for various reggae styles, from "Wet Roots" to "High Tuned".

MIDI Grooves: Includes a library of professional MIDI drum and hand percussion grooves performed by Axel Anderson, covering standard one-drops, steppers, and rockers. Technical Specifications and Requirements
